Best 81501 Colorado Public Middle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 526 students in 81501, CO.
Public middle schools in zipcode 81501 have an average math proficiency score of 17% (versus the Colorado public middle school average of 30%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 43% statewide average). Middle schools in 81501, CO have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Colorado public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 26%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Colorado public middle school average of 50% (majority Hispanic).
